ahumananimal -> RE: If You were President (11/4/2008 1:49:55 PM)


quote:

ORIGINAL: OrionTheWolf

So what are the topĀ 2 things you would concentrate on fixing if you were elected President? How would you go about these things?



1. Rebuild and continue to refine the wall of division between church and state.

2. Appoint Supreme Court Justices (when applicable) in a fair and balanced manner with the protection of the Constitution and the freedom of all American citizenry in mind.

3. Review and if possible work to eliminate or redirect through legal channels any and all misallocation of state resources set in place by the previous administration, including, but not limited to, government programs, interior task forces and their associated operatives.

4. Focus on alternative energy and work toward wresting our country free of its excessive dependance on foreign oil through pursuing solar, wind, nuclear and local oil sources.

5. Offer incentives for companies to invest in the American worker, not outsourcing labor to foreign countries.

6. Work to rebuild our standing with the world by refocusing on the known loci of terrorism and fostering a productive dialog with hostile nations.

7. Work to rebuild the public trust in the office of President and both parties in the House.

8. Invest in new technology research and innovation, particularly alternative energy, biotech and medicine.

There's more, but that's what comes to mind at the moment. Sorry for the eight, rather than two, but this day and age is filled with so many challenges and problems that must be addressed.

Can't do that, it would be impossible to police this.  either you'd be sending innocent doctors to jail left and right, or you wouldn't send the guilty to jail, or both.
The only way to implement something like this, is rather then trying to police doctors who are already out there making money, set up a medical system similar to the Office of Public Defenders for lawyers.  Have a special group of federal paid doctors in a federal hospital for people who can't afford medical care.  This way you provide medical care for people who can't afford insurance, you provide jobs for young doctors, and you don't kill off the medical professon.
Also, remember that they spent 19 years on average in school studying and working as an intern in countless hospitals to get where they are.  They've earned what they make, their not just leaches trying to steal money with their high prices.
